Ordinance Providing Delinquent Real Property Taxpayers Amnesty from Payment of Surcharges and Penalties for the Year 2016 and Prior Years

Marikina City Ordinance No. 036-16 • Local Tax Ordinances • Marikina City • Jun 29, 2016

Full text

June 29, 2016 MARIKINA CITY ORDINANCE NO. 036-16 ORDINANCE PROVIDING DELINQUENT REAL PROPERTY TAXPAYERS AMNESTY FROM PAYMENT OF SURCHARGES AND PENALTIES FOR THE YEAR 2016 AND PRIOR YEARS Introduced by: Councilor Joseph B. Banzon, Councilor Ariel V. Cuaresma, Councilor Thaddeus Antonio M. Santos, Jr. WHEREAS , Local Government Units have the power to grant amnesty as provided in Section 192 of Republic Act No. 7160, otherwise known as the Local Government Code of 1991 which states that: HTcADC "SECTION 192. Authority to Grant Tax Exemption Privileges. Local government units may, through ordinances duly approved, grant tax exemptions, incentives or reliefs under such terms and conditions as they may deem necessary." WHEREAS ,the grant of relief is appropriate as remedy to the City Government's real property collection effort and also a form of support to taxpayers who are experiencing financial difficulties; NOW THEREFORE, BE IT ORDAINED AS IT IS HEREBY ORDAINED, by the SANGGUNIANG PANLUNGSOD of MARIKINA ,in session duly assembled: SECTION 1. The City Government of Marikina hereby grants a 100% relief or amnesty on surcharges and penalties to real property taxpayers of Marikina City who have been delinquent in their payment as of June 30, 2016. SECTION 2. The 100% relief on interests and penalties shall cover the following real properties: (a) Real properties which are undeclared and subject to the back taxes; and (b) Real properties which are declared but real property taxes thereon have not been paid. SECTION 3. Excluded from the amnesty are the following real properties: (a) Real properties of delinquent taxpayers currently being disposed of at public auction; (b) Real properties of delinquent taxpayers with pending criminal cases in court for tax delinquency; and (c) Real properties of delinquent taxpayers which are subject to the one-year redemption period. SECTION 4. The amnesty period ends on June 30, 2017 after which, a public auction of all delinquent real properties shall immediately follow. SECTION 5. As a condition to avail of the tax relief, all real property delinquencies must be paid in full within the prescribed amnesty period. Failure to pay the taxes due shall automatically invalidate the amnesty granted. SECTION 6.
